Rasak encourages his clients to establish three buckets of money: short-term, mid-term, and long-term:

  • Short-Term - This emphasizes the importance of having reserves and/or earmarking capital for big purchases in the next 12, 24 or 36 months. "There is the whole adage that you should have 6 months' worth of expenses in cash at all times for emergencies, and so forth. Cash is great, because it's flexible, and it's accessible. But it essentially earns zero rate of return, and someone could argue that you're actually losing money due to inflation. So, I want our clients to hold on to some cash, but I don't recommend hoarding cash unless they're going to utilize it on a big purchase or something of that nature in the next one to three years."
  • Mid-Term - Mid-term planning is roughly a four to eight year time frame. "That's where many of our clients are saying, look, we don't need these dollars today. We're willing to engage the capital markets." Rasak doesn't recommend investing in the capital markets if his clients think they'll need to use this capital in the next 12 to 36 months. He believes the markets are too volatile to invest in if clients need to use those dollars in the next 1-3 years.
  • Long-Term - The long-term bucket is something Dave often refers to as "over the shoulder dough". This is the area where he encourages clients to take advantage of qualified plans such as 401(k)s, as well as IRA's, cash value (permanent life) life insurance premiums, residential rental real estate, etc. "We really try to help our clients position themselves in this fashion because now we have some strategy as it relates to the dollars. Not only from a time standpoint, meaning short, mid and long, but also from a taxable perspective. Dollars in the mid-term bucket invested in a brokerage/advisory account are taxable, dollars in traditional 401(k)s and IRAs are deposited pre-tax and taxed at withdrawal, and dollars inside of Roth IRA's/401(k)'s are deposited post-tax and not taxed at withdrawal. This will ultimately provide more optionality in our clients' lives."
